Manufacturing Engineer

Position Summary

We are seeking a hands‑on Mechanical / Manufacturing Engineer to support production operations in a metalworking environment. This is a newly created position reporting into the Manufacturing Team, designed to bridge engineering, operations, and continuous improvement.

The ideal candidate will have a strong engineering background, experience working directly on the production floor, and the ability to support CNC programming, equipment setup, and Lean manufacturing initiatives. This role is critical in improving processes, standardizing work instructions, supporting automation efforts, and ensuring safe and efficient operations.


Key Responsibilities

Manufacturing & Production Support

  • Provide day‑to‑day engineering support on the production floor
  • Assist operations and operators with CNC programming, setup, and troubleshooting
  • Serve as a technical resource for operators working with manually and semi‑automated equipment
  • Ensure all manufacturing activities meet safety, quality, and productivity standards

CNC Programming & Equipment Integration

  • Support and assist with programming and operation of:
    • CNC machines
    • Automated saws (recipe selection, speed/feed optimization)
    • Leveling equipment (programming based on manuals and process requirements)
    • Rolling press equipment (understanding force, pressure, and metal behavior)
  • Troubleshoot programming and process issues related to CNC integration
  • Support ongoing equipment improvements and capability expansion

Process Improvement & Lean Manufacturing

  • Apply Lean manufacturing principles to improve efficiency and reduce waste
  • Identify, develop, and implement process improvement projects
  • Support continuous improvement initiatives across multiple manufacturing projects
  • Analyze current processes and recommend improvements for safety, quality, and throughput

Documentation & Standardization

  • Understand, create, and improve work instructions and SOPs
  • Ensure operators are following documented processes and procedures
  • Standardize best practices across production areas
  • Support training and knowledge transfer through clear documentation

Project & Automation Support

  • Support project‑based work related to manufacturing initiatives
  • Assist with installation and transition to automated manufacturing cells, including:
    • 5‑axis robotic arm
    • CNC mill
    • CNC lathe
  • Work cross‑functionally during the company’s transition toward increased automation

Manufacturing Environment

  • Metalworking operation producing large metal discs
    • Individual, one‑by‑one production (not high‑volume line manufacturing)
    • Part weights ranging from 100–400 lbs
  • Two factory locations
  • Combination of manual operations, hand automation, and CNC equipment
